Nutrient Management and Water Quality on Vegetable Farms

Nutrient management is part of a suite of farming practices aimed at supporting healthy soil and protecting water quality. Nutrients for vegetable crop production are managed with crop rotation, cover cropping, soil testing, and appropriate and timely applications of fertilizers and soil amendments. Soil Testing in High Tunnels

Why should you use a different soil test for high tunnels? Management of high tunnel soils differs from field soils, largely because of the lack of rainfall and because higher rates of amendments are needed to achieve yield potential in high tunnels.
